Abstract

A new scheme to transfer bidirectional data streams between a digital display and a computer is disclosed. This bidirectional data transfer can make several I/O devices attach to a display. Existing digital display interfaces are usually unidirectional from a computing to a display. Due to the nature of the existing clocking scheme, backward data transfer from the display side to the computer requires a backward clock. This invention discloses a scheme to send data bidirectionally without sending the additional backward clock. This invention also discloses a scheme to tolerate jitters from the clock source. With this approach, this new interface can make a digital display an I/O concentrator.
